DOSE OPTIMIZATION WITH mAs REDUCTION OF 15% USING COMPUTED RADIOGRAPHY ON RADIOGRAPHIC EXAMINATIONS PELVIC AP PROJECTION

INTAN CAHYA - Personal Name; Nursama Heru Apriantoro - Personal Name; Muhammad Irsal - Personal Name; Shinta Gunawati - Personal Name; Mahfud Edy - Personal Name;

Background: Routine pelvic radiograph examination commonly performed in diagnostic radiology services is a pelvic examination of anteroposterior projection (AP). This results in
direct exposure to ionizing radiation to the internal organs in the lower abdomen, especially the reproductive organs. Purpose: Optimizing the dosage of AP projection pelvic radiographs.
Method: Research is conducted quantitatively and used experimental approach with an analysis of 15% mAs reduction from the standard mAs value on AP projection pelvic examination on
radiation dose and image quality using anthropomorphic phantoms. The radiation dose analysis uses the exposure index indicator. In contrast, the image quality uses the Visual Grading Analysis
method, then it was continued with the Kappa Cohens test to determine the level of agreement between 2 respondents. Result: The exposure factor with the mAs value reduced by 15% from
the standard exposure factor on the AP projection pelvic radiography affected the decrease in the value exposure index. The EI value generated from the optimization exposure factor shows a
decrease to 300 EI, which means the dose produced is only half of the standard exposure factor dose but still produces an acceptable image, as evidenced by the VGA score. As an assessment of
image quality. In this study, there was no significant difference with range VGA scores 1,7. Besides that, the test had the Kappa Cohens level of agreement with a value of 0.5-0.8. Conclusion:
All images resulting from the 15% mAs value reduction variation can be used as a diagnostic assessment.
